Fo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or structural damage. These services typically include evaluating the extent of foundation problems, implementing stabilization techniques, and repairing cracks or compromised areas. The goal is to ensure the structural integrity of a property and prevent further damage that could affect the safety and usability of the building.
Problems that foundation repair aims to resolve often include u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, doors and windows that no longer close properly, and signs of settling such as sinking or tilting. Over time, soil movement, moisture fluctuations, and poor construction can lead to foundation issues. Addressing these problems promptly helps to prevent more extensive damage, which could result in costly repairs or compromised safety.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hinckley,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used. Smaller cracks or minor issues may cost closer to $2,000, while more extensive repairs can reach upwards of $7,000.
Factors Affecting Prices - Factors such as soil conditions, foundation type, and accessibility influence the overall cost, with some projects requiring specialized equipment or techniques. For example, piering or underpinning may add to the total expense compared to simple crack injections.
Average Cost Range - On average, homeowners in Hinckley, OH, can expect to pay between $3,000 and $6,000 for comprehensive foundation repairs. Exact prices vary based on the size and severity of the foundation issues encountered.
Cost Variability - Costs can vary significantly depending on the local contractor and specific project requirements, with some repairs costing as low as $1,500 and others exceeding $10,000 for complex, large-scale fixes. What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and gaps around window and door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ration of foundation repair varies dep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used; a local contractor can provide an estimate based on the specific situation.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my property? Repair processes can cause some disruption, but experienced service providers aim to minimize inconvenience and restore the area efficiently.
What causes foundation problems in Hinckley, OH? Common causes include so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or drainage, and natural settling over time.
How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age management,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or problems early can help prevent future damage; consulting a local expert can provide tailored advice.
